PreferencesView: Show ARS blue rate popup if selected

This commit is contained in:
Alva Swanson 2025-01-01 20:16:01 +00:00
parent 6c1e45eb53
commit 4bb7b38a0e
No known key found for this signature in database
GPG key ID: 004760E77F753090

View file

@ -26,6 +26,7 @@ import bisq.desktop.components.AutoTooltipSlideToggleButton;
import bisq.desktop.components.InputTextField;
import bisq.desktop.components.PasswordTextField;
import bisq.desktop.components.TitledGroupBg;
import bisq.desktop.components.paymentmethods.ArsBlueRatePopup;
import bisq.desktop.main.overlays.popups.Popup;
import bisq.desktop.main.overlays.windows.EditCustomExplorerWindow;
import bisq.desktop.util.GUIUtil;
@ -1029,8 +1030,13 @@ public class PreferencesView extends ActivatableViewAndModel<GridPane, Preferenc
preferredTradeCurrencyComboBox.setVisibleRowCount(12);
preferredTradeCurrencyComboBox.setOnAction(e -> {
TradeCurrency selectedItem = preferredTradeCurrencyComboBox.getSelectionModel().getSelectedItem();
if (selectedItem != null)
if (selectedItem != null) {
preferences.setPreferredTradeCurrency(selectedItem);
if (ArsBlueRatePopup.isTradeCurrencyArgentinePesos(selectedItem)) {
ArsBlueRatePopup.showMaybe();
}
}
GUIUtil.updateTopAltcoin(preferences);
});